Note: For Excel 2007, click the Microsoft Office Button , and then click Excel Options. Click Add-Ins, and then in the Manage box, select Excel Add-ins. Click Go. In the Add-Ins available box, select the Solver Add-in check box, and then click OK.

WebJul 9, 2024 · Step 1: Estimate the appropriate spot and forward rates for a known par value curve. Step 2: Construct the interest rate tree using the assumed volatility and the interest rate model. Step 3: Determine the appropriate values for the zero-coupon bonds at each node using backward induction. WebQuestion: USE EXCEL SOLVER Broker Sonya Wong is currently trying to maximize her profit in the bond market. Four bonds are available for purchase and sale at the bid and ask prices shown in the first table below. Sonya can buy up to 1000 units of each bond at the ask price or sell up to 1000 units of each bond at the bid price.
